我可以使用相同类型的多个元素创建soap请求吗?

时间:2011-08-05 13:28:20

标签: xml wcf soap

我的肥皂请求有问题。这是创建请求的代码:

 [OperationContract()]
    [return: MessageParameter(Name = "Dealer")]
    List<Dealer> GetDealer(String AccountNumber);   

这是生成的请求:

  <tem:GetDealer>
     <!--Optional:-->
     <tem:AccountNumber>?</tem:AccountNumber>
  </tem:GetDealer>

但我需要能够请求多个AccountNumbers。 有人知道如何在不创建AccountNumber列表的情况下执行此操作,因为那样我将在AccountNumber中获得额外的元素。

所以请求必须是这样的:

<DealerRequest>
    <AccountNumber>1</AccountNumber>
    <AccountNumber>2</AccountNumber>
    <AccountNumber>3</AccountNumber>
</DealerRequest>

0 个答案:

没有答案